Ethical Automation Governance

Meaning ● Ethical Automation Governance in the SMB context refers to the framework of policies, procedures, and oversight mechanisms that guide the responsible and compliant implementation of automation technologies, aligning with business values and mitigating potential risks; automation, despite the efficiencies and cost savings, needs a considered governance structure. First, consider how ethical considerations tie directly to the longevity and reputation of an SMB; neglecting ethical oversight in automation could damage client trust and employee morale. Furthermore, effective governance can actually spur more confident and widespread automation adoption across departments. Finally, a strong ethical automation framework ensures SMBs comply with relevant data privacy regulations and avoid potential legal complications.
